黑狐家游戏

密码管理软件原理,密码管理 开源

欧气 4 0

标题:探索密码管理开源软件的奥秘与优势

一、引言

在当今数字化时代,密码已经成为我们保护个人信息和重要数据的关键工具,随着互联网的发展和应用的增多,我们面临着越来越多的密码管理挑战,为了更好地应对这些挑战,许多开发者开始关注密码管理开源软件,本文将深入探讨密码管理开源软件的原理,并分析其在密码管理方面的优势。

二、密码管理开源软件的原理

(一)加密技术

密码管理开源软件通常采用先进的加密技术来保护用户的密码,这些技术包括对称加密、非对称加密和哈希函数等,对称加密算法使用相同的密钥进行加密和解密,如 AES 算法;非对称加密算法使用一对密钥,即公钥和私钥,公钥用于加密,私钥用于解密,如 RSA 算法;哈希函数则将任意长度的输入转换为固定长度的输出,如 SHA-256 算法,通过这些加密技术,密码管理开源软件可以确保用户的密码在存储和传输过程中不被泄露。

(二)密码生成与存储

密码管理开源软件通常提供密码生成功能,帮助用户生成强密码,这些密码生成器可以根据用户的需求生成包含大小写字母、数字和特殊字符的复杂密码,密码管理开源软件还采用安全的存储方式来保存用户的密码,如加密数据库、硬件安全模块等,这些存储方式可以确保用户的密码在本地设备上不被窃取。

(三)身份验证与授权

密码管理开源软件通常支持多种身份验证方式,如密码、指纹、面部识别等,这些身份验证方式可以帮助用户更方便地登录到密码管理软件,并确保只有合法用户能够访问用户的密码,密码管理开源软件还支持授权功能,用户可以根据需要为不同的应用程序或网站分配不同的密码,从而提高密码的安全性。

三、密码管理开源软件的优势

(一)安全性高

密码管理开源软件通常采用先进的加密技术和安全的存储方式,能够有效保护用户的密码不被泄露,与商业密码管理软件相比,密码管理开源软件的安全性更高,因为其源代码是公开的,用户可以对其进行审查和验证。

(二)功能强大

密码管理开源软件通常提供丰富的功能,如密码生成、密码存储、身份验证、授权等,这些功能可以满足用户的不同需求,帮助用户更好地管理密码,与商业密码管理软件相比,密码管理开源软件的功能更加强大,因为其开发者可以根据用户的需求进行定制和扩展。

(三)成本低

密码管理开源软件通常是免费的,用户可以免费使用,与商业密码管理软件相比,密码管理开源软件的成本更低,因为其不需要用户支付高昂的授权费用。

(四)社区支持

密码管理开源软件通常有一个活跃的社区,用户可以在社区中交流经验、分享问题和解决方案,与商业密码管理软件相比,密码管理开源软件的社区支持更加强大,因为其开发者可以与用户进行更密切的合作,共同改进和完善软件。

四、密码管理开源软件的应用场景

(一)个人用户

密码管理开源软件可以帮助个人用户更好地管理密码,保护个人信息和重要数据的安全,个人用户可以使用密码管理开源软件来生成强密码、存储密码、管理密码的访问权限等。

(二)企业用户

密码管理开源软件可以帮助企业用户更好地管理密码,保护企业信息和重要数据的安全,企业用户可以使用密码管理开源软件来生成强密码、存储密码、管理密码的访问权限、进行身份验证和授权等。

(三)政府机构

密码管理开源软件可以帮助政府机构更好地管理密码,保护国家信息和重要数据的安全,政府机构可以使用密码管理开源软件来生成强密码、存储密码、管理密码的访问权限、进行身份验证和授权等。

五、结论

密码管理开源软件是一种安全、功能强大、成本低、社区支持的密码管理工具,它可以帮助用户更好地管理密码,保护个人信息和重要数据的安全,随着互联网的发展和应用的增多,密码管理开源软件的应用场景将会越来越广泛。

标签: #原理 #开源 #密码管理

黑狐家游戏
  • 评论列表

留言评论